Do You Need a Milk Frother?

Published in Coffee Accessories 3 mins read

While not strictly required for plain coffee, a milk frother is recommended if you want to elevate your home coffee experience and create specialty drinks.

Whether or not you "need" a milk frother depends largely on your coffee preferences. If you enjoy basic black coffee or coffee with just a splash of milk, it might not be essential for you. However, for those who appreciate cafe-style beverages, a milk frother is a valuable tool.

Elevating Your Coffee Experience

The primary benefit highlighted is the ability of a good milk frother to turn a standard cup of coffee into a specialty drink. This means you can easily replicate your favorite cafe orders right in your own kitchen.

With a milk frother, you can effortlessly prepare popular beverages such as:

  • Cappuccinos: Featuring equal parts espresso, steamed milk, and milk foam.
  • Lattes: Characterized by espresso with a large amount of steamed milk and a thin layer of foam.
  • Macchiatos: Typically espresso "marked" with a dollop of milk foam (espresso macchiato) or steamed milk with espresso layered on top (latte macchiato).

Practical Considerations

Milk frothers come in various forms, from simple handheld wands to integrated systems on espresso machines and automatic electric pitchers. Manual options offer control, while automatic ones provide convenience and consistent results. Most are relatively easy to use and clean, making them a practical addition to any coffee lover's kitchen.
